Output eddd91c30275674ceebad86bfc5d0c008c57516d3dcfb5141b6a2f4d5ee9248e:0

value
42621
script pubkey
OP_0 OP_PUSHBYTES_20 3ef30645cbeff9ee0fd7d27ad1a3ef45a7e08825
address
bc1q8mesv3wtalu7ur7h6fadrgl0gkn7pzp95mx87e
transaction
eddd91c30275674ceebad86bfc5d0c008c57516d3dcfb5141b6a2f4d5ee9248e
spent
true